I'll try..... Other than in the past when we had overpowering O-Lines that used to try to challenge themselves by telling the other team what play was coming up next... We should have someone calling plays that catches the other team off guard. I would hope Frost calls plays ''by committee'' to a certain extent..With input from his OC and possibly his running game coordinator. Otherwise, one person would likely tend to show trends..(My biggest worry about having someone like Lubbick as our OC because of his shared History with Frost...Maybe thinking too much alike). It would be interesting to see play calling alternated by Offensive series, quarter, or maybe just games to see what works. Seems like there are G.A.s or other helpers keeping track of what your upcoming opponent tends to call depending on down/distance/clock and adjusting their Defensive calls accordingly. Having more than the same person calling plays all the time would help counteract that.

Strange how much this podcast by a stand-up comic with an actual expert on infectious diseases made me change my mind on the seriousness of this ''beer flu''...Doubt I'd ever trust mainstream media this much.. Michael Osterholm is an internationally recognized expert in infectious disease epidemiology. He is Regents Professor, McKnight Presidential Endowed Chair in Public Health, the director of the Center for Infectious Disease Research and Policy (CIDRAP), Distinguished Teaching Professor in the Division of Environmental Health Sciences, School of Public Health, a professor in the Technological Leadership Institute, College of Science and Engineering, and an adjunct professor in the Medical School, all at the University of Minnesota. -
